- Unable to access SHiFT code menu
- Our engineers are aware of an issue where players may not be able to access the SHiFT code menu when their privacy settings on their profile are set to “Blocked”. We are investigating fixes to possibly be included in a future update. In the meantime, you can access the SHiFT code menu by using a privacy setting other than “Blocked”. - Unable to use “Invite Friends” prompt
- We’re aware of an issue where users may be unable to use the “Invite Friends” prompt after suspending the title on the main menu. The team is currently investigating possible resolutions. In the meantime, you can fix this by changing your network options to ‘offline’, and then back to ‘online’. - Progression blocker in the mission “Plan B” (Borderlands 2)
- We are aware of an issue where the player may encounter a progression blocker when a client player buys all of Crazy Earl’s upgrades in another game session before reaching the mission “Plan B” in Sanctuary.
